The Importance of Influenza Vaccination for the 2020 – 2021 Season

Ensuring immunization services are maintained (or reinitiated) is essential for protecting individuals and communities from vaccine-preventable diseases and outbreaks. Influenza vaccination will be doubly important this 2020-2021 influenza season by reducing: The impact of respiratory illnesses in the population, and The burden on an already strained healthcare system.
